Texture-GS: Disentangling the Geometry and Texture for 3D Gaussian Splatting Editing
March 18, 2024, 4:44 a.m. | Tian-Xing Xu, Wenbo Hu, Yu-Kun Lai, Ying Shan, Song-Hai Zhang
cs.CV updates on arXiv.org arxiv.org
Abstract: 3D Gaussian splatting, emerging as a groundbreaking approach, has drawn increasing attention for its capabilities of high-fidelity reconstruction and real-time rendering. However, it couples the appearance and geometry of the scene within the Gaussian attributes, which hinders the flexibility of editing operations, such as texture swapping. To address this issue, we propose a novel approach, namely Texture-GS, to disentangle the appearance from the geometry by representing it as a 2D texture mapped onto the 3D …
